About Me:
Native Austinite and Democratic activist, Rachel Farris writes meanrachel.com, a popular progressive blog, that covers everything from congressional races, to human interest stories, to places with cool piano bars.
Her work has been anthologized in several books, including Women Write the War. As an employee at an Austin-based dot-com, she is a regular contributor to international HR industry magazines such as MOBILITY. She also pens the monthly e-mail newsletter "Open Tab," published by Texas Monthly.
Farris was recently the subject of several stories in the mainstream media as a result of her car's license plate which is OBAMA.
